Crispy Cheesesteak Wraps

Crispy Cheesesteak Wraps are filled with shaved steak, melty muenster cheese, caramelized onions, and sautéed bell peppers, wrapped in a crispy whole wheat tortilla.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ings 8 wraps
Calories 410 kcal

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il divided, plus extra as needed
  • 1 lb shaved steak chopped
  • ¼ cup low sodium soy sauce
  • 1 yellow onion thinly sliced
  • 1 red bell pepper thinly sliced
  • 1 green bell pepper thinly sliced
  • 8 whole wheat tortillas
  • 1 package sliced muenster cheese at least 8 slices
  • ½ cup mayo
  • 1 large spoonful sour cream
  • ¼ lemon squeezed
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
  • ½ teaspoon smoked paprika
  • ¼ teaspoon oregano
  • ¼ teaspoon garlic powder
  • pinch of salt

Instructions

  •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the shaved steak and brown it for about 3-4 minutes.
  • Add soy sauce, sliced onions, and bell peppers. Cook everything together until the veggies soften, about 5-7 minutes.
  • Remove the mixture from the heat and let it cool.
  • Spread mayo and sour cream evenly over each tortilla.
  • Place steak and veggie mixture on one side of each tortilla, top with slices of muenster cheese, and roll tightly.
  • Heat more olive oil in the skillet, place each wrap seam side down, and cook for 2-3 minutes on each side or until golden brown.
  • Slice the wraps in half and serve hot.

Notes

Chop the shaved steak before cooking to make it easier to assemble the wrap. It also makes it easier for kids to eat.
